(Vatican Radio) Pope Francis, Monday received in audience the President of the Bolivarian
Republic of Venezuela, Nicolás Maduro. The meeting focused on the social and political
situation of the country, after the recent death of President Hugo Chávez as well
as on some current issues, such as poverty and the fight against crime and drug trafficking.
Also
discussed was the historical presence of the Church Catholic in the country and its
decisive contribution to education, charity, health care and it was agreed that there
needs to be a constant and sincere dialogue between the Catholic Bishops' Conference
of Venezuela and the State, for the development of the entire nation.
Finally,
the meeting focused on the regional situation, with particular reference to the peace
process in Colombia.
